One of the primary responsibilities of fire suppliers is to supply fire extinguishers. These portable devices are designed to put out small fires before they can escalate and cause significant damage. There are different types of fire extinguishers for various types of fires, such as Class A, Class B, and Class C fires. fire suppliers need to have a variety of extinguishers in stock to meet the needs of different environments and industries.
In addition to providing fire extinguishers, fire suppliers also offer fire alarms and detection systems. These devices are crucial for detecting fires in their early stages when they are still manageable. A quick response to a fire alarm can save lives and prevent the spread of fire to other areas of a building. fire suppliers must ensure that their fire alarms are up to date and functioning correctly to provide maximum protection.
Furthermore, fire suppliers also supply fire suppression systems. These systems are designed to suppress fires in large, high-risk environments where traditional fire extinguishers may not be enough. Fire suppression systems use different methods, such as water mist, foam, or gas, to extinguish fires quickly and efficiently. Fire suppliers must work closely with their clients to determine the best type of fire suppression system for their specific needs.

Another essential service provided by fire suppliers is fire safety training. It’s not enough to have the right fire protection equipment in place – individuals must also know how to use it effectively in an emergency. Fire suppliers offer training programs that teach people how to operate fire extinguishers, evacuate buildings safely, and respond to fire alarms. By educating individuals on fire safety best practices, fire suppliers empower them to take action and prevent tragedies.
Fire suppliers also offer maintenance services to ensure that fire protection equipment remains in good working condition. Regular maintenance and inspections are crucial to the performance of fire extinguishers, alarms, and suppression systems. Fire suppliers must conduct thorough checks and tests to identify any issues and make repairs promptly. By keeping fire protection equipment well-maintained, fire suppliers help their clients maintain a safe environment.
